Output 2ca672b104dc514854e8f618a658bc65604f56fd265f3d735623fbd59dd4afb1:59

value
1781573
script pubkey
OP_0 OP_PUSHBYTES_20 ec530b3b8bfe0ff847d65a8cc745ee55af32f95f
address
bc1qa3fskwutlc8ls37kt2xvw30w2khn972lcp25jc
transaction
2ca672b104dc514854e8f618a658bc65604f56fd265f3d735623fbd59dd4afb1
spent
true